
Danish company Bladena, which develops and produces technological solutions and improvements for wind turbines, is set to get a new chairman. The candidate is former GE Offshore and Vestas CEO Anders Søe-Jensen, who has a 17-year history of executive posts within wind.
The new chairman will help Bladena implement its technology, repair and design solutions for wind turbine blades, industry-wide.
